impact.com has an employee rating of 3.6 out of 5 stars, based on 377 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The impact.com employ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Media & Communication indust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

The workplace offers a commendable work-life balance, ensuring employees are not overwhelmed with their workload. The workload assigned is reasonable, allowing for a manageable and stress-free environment. The atmosphere is light and easy-going, fostering a positive work culture. If there were an option to give half-star ratings, I would rate it 3.5 stars overall.

Cons

While the work environment is undoubtedly positive and laid-back, I found the career advancement opportunities to be quite limited. For developers seeking exposure to cutting-edge technologies that they can apply to future roles, this company may not be the best fit.
